About

This app helps individuals with diabetes track their glucose levels alongside various physical activities. It provides personalized insights into how exercise impacts blood sugar, enabling users to stay active safely and confidently. Integrate data from multiple sources for comprehensive health management.

Track glucose, exercise, carbs, and insulin
Personalized insights on activity impact
Integrate data from wearables and nutrition apps
Supports all activity levels
Trends and analysis for optimization
Simple and intuitive design

FAQ

What is Enhance-d?

Enhance-d is a health and fitness app designed to help people with diabetes track their glucose levels alongside their physical activities. It offers personalized insights to understand how exercise affects blood sugar.

Can Enhance-d track insulin and carbs?

Yes, Enhance-d allows you to track carbohydrates synced from nutrition apps or manual entries, and view insulin data from sources like Dexcom, Freestyle Libre (via Gluroo), or manual inputs.

Does Enhance-d integrate with other health devices?

Yes, Enhance-d supports integration with glucose sources, activity data, health wearables, smartwatches, and nutrition information to provide a comprehensive view of your health.

What types of activities can I track with Enhance-d?

You can track all activity levels with Enhance-d, from intense sports and gym workouts to casual walks and even home projects, ensuring all your efforts are accounted for.
